American Country Singer Justin Carter has died in an alleged accidental shooting with a gun that was being used as a music video prop.

According to ET Online, the rising country singer, 35, died from a gunshot wound in an accident that took place while a gun was being used as a prop for a music video being filmed in his apartment.

He died on Saturday, the same week he had signed a management deal and released an independent single, Love Affair, to digital services including iTunes and Spotify.

Carter’s manager, Mark Atherton of Triple Threat, said the deep-voiced singer had inked a contract with the company just days before the 16 March accident.

Carter’s mother, Cindy McClellan, said a gun the singer had in his pocket “went off and caught my son in the corner of his eye.”

She also told ABC 13: “His music was his world. He was always there for everybody.”
